Sr Specialist, Provider Engagement - Quality/HEDIS (Remote in FL)

Job Description

Job Summary The Sr Specialist, Provider Engagement role implements Health Plan provider engagement strategy to reputed company positive quality and risk adjustment outcomes through effective provider engagement activities. Ensures the core set of Tier 2 providers in the Health Plan have engagement plans to meet annual quality and risk adjustment goals. Drives coaching and collaboration with providers to improve performance through regular meetings and action plans. Addresses practice environment challenges to reputed company program goals and improve health outcomes. Tracks engagement activities using standard tools, facilitates data exchanges, and supports training and problem resolution for the Provider Engagement team. Communicates effectively with reputed company and maintains compliance with policies. Please reputed company sure to include any experience in HEDIS/Quality improvement. Job Duties

  • Ensures assigned Tier 2 & Tier 3 providers have a Provider Engagement plan to meet annual quality & risk adjustment performance goals.
  • Drives provider partner coaching and collaboration to improve quality performance and risk adjustment accuracy through consistent provider meetings, action item development and execution.
  • Addresses challenges/barriers in the practice environment impeding successful attainment of program goals and understands solutions required to improve health outcomes.
  • Drives provider participation in Molina risk adjustment and quality efforts (e.g. Supplemental data, EMR reputed company, Clinical Profiles programs) and use of the Molina Provider Collaboration Portal.
  • Tracks reputed company engagement and training activities using standard Molina Provider Engagement tools to measure effectiveness both reputed company and across Molina Health Plans.
  • Serves as a Provider Engagement subject matter expert; works collaboratively reputed company the Health Plan and with shared service partners to ensure alignment to business goals.
  • Assist Provider Engagement Specialists with training and problem escalation.
  • Accountable for use of standard Molina Provider Engagement reports and training materials.
  • Facilitates connectivity to internal partners to support appropriate data exchanges, documentation education and patient engagement activities.
  • Develops, organizes, analyzes, documents and implements processes and procedures as prescribed by Plan and Corporate policies.
  • Communicates comfortably and effectively with Physician Leaders, Providers, Practice Managers, Medical Assistants reputed company assigned provider practices.
  • Maintains the highest level of compliance.
  • This position may require same day out of office travel approximately 0 - 80% of the time, depending upon location.

Job Qualifications REQUIRED QUALIFICATIONS:

  • Bachelor's degree in Business, reputed company, Nursing, or reputed company field, or equivalent combination of education and relevant experience
  • Minimum 3 years of experience improving provider quality performance through provider engagement, practice transformation, managed care quality improvement, or equivalent experience
  • Experience with various managed reputed company provider compensation methodologies, including but not limited to: fee-for-service, value-based care, and capitation
  • Strong working knowledge of quality metrics and risk adjustment practices across reputed company business lines
  • Demonstrates data analytic skills
  • Operational knowledge and experience with PowerPoint, reputed company, and Visio
  • Effective communication skills
  • Strong leadership skills
